Webb1 apr. 2024 · A loud burst of voice or voices; a violent and sudden outcry, especially that of a multitude expressing joy, triumph, exultation, anger, or great effort. give out a shout. … Webb29 jan. 2015 · So when there is no stress we observe just a single 't'. In the following examples the stressed syllables are premarked with an apostrophe: 'rocketed. e'licited. 'billeted. 'ratcheted. 'exited. However if the last syllable is stressed then we will see a doubling of the consonant: ga'rotted.

It requires the past participle crié, which is attached to the subject pronoun and a conjugation of avoir (an … flintstone vitamin ugly mugsWebb6 dec. 2024 · For most verbs, the past participle is formed by adding -ed or -d to the end of the root form of the verb. For example, the past participle of jump is jumped and the past participle of excite is excited.
